St. Lawrence State Hospital Preservation Society – Our Mission

“The historical structures of the St. Lawrence State Hospital are worth being memorialized, not dismantled, though their destruction is most likely inevitable. They stand now with windows broken, paint peeling, and frames crumbling. The St. Lawrence State Hospital Preservation Society’s mission is to collect, preserve, interpret, store, and disseminate anything historically related or relevant to the hospital, whether it be New York State Assembly documents, plans and drawings, reports, or personal accounts. Countless hours already have been spent gathering much of this information, which is, in turn, available to you here, on the Society’s official website. And countless more hours are still to be spent before this work is complete. It has been a long and often difficult process, and it has only just begun. We’re hoping that as more people become interested in this research and take up the challenge to help preserve it, information that we might never have expected will come to light, furthering this cause.”
